Job Title: Payroll Specialist
Location: Everett WA 98204
Contract Duration: 4 Months
Overview:
We are seeking a skilled Payroll Specialist to support bi-weekly payroll processing for a large and diverse workforce. This role focuses on accurate timekeeping data entry reconciliation of payroll reports and providing excellent employee support. The ideal candidate is organized dependable and comfortable working in a deadline-driven environment.
Responsibilities:
- Process payroll exception entries and verify documentation accuracy.
- Maintain and audit payroll and timekeeping records.
- Respond to payroll questions from employees and departments.
- Reconcile payroll deductions and assist with vendor payments.
- Support leave-related pay calculations including FMLA and workers compensation.
- Ensure compliance with labor regulations and organizational policies.
Qualifications:
- 3 years of payroll experience required.
- Strong proficiency using payroll software and Microsoft Excel.
- Knowledge of FMLA/FLSA and payroll compliance.
- Associate degree in Accounting or related field preferred (or equivalent experience).
Preferred:
- Experience with PeopleSoft UKG/Kronos or Trapeze.
